It all began with wanting something different, and started off with wanting a new Paint Job and a reversed Tailgate handle. Needless to say it turned into a major project that was worth its while. I would love to give special thanks to my Brother in Law Kevin Blanchard, without his help it would have never even started. I would also like to thank Carl Still for some frame mods and Mark Hollingsworth for his impressive Graphic Masterpiece.
